Why Asmara Needs Rooftop Photovoltaic Energy Storage

Asmara, known for its high-altitude location and abundant sunshine, is ideal for rooftop photovoltaic (PV) systems. With frequent power outages and rising electricity costs, energy storage solutions paired with solar panels offer a game-changing alternative. Did you know? Buildings in Asmara receive an average of 6.8 hours of daily sunlight – enough to power a mid-sized business for 10 hours using modern PV systems.

Overcoming Challenges in Rooftop Solar Adoption

While the benefits are clear, let's address the elephant in the room: upfront costs. A typical 5kW residential system in Asmara costs around $7,500–$9,000, including installation. But here's the kicker – government subsidies now cover up to 30% of these costs for commercial users. Plus, payback periods have dropped from 8 years to just 4.5 years since 2020 due to improved battery efficiency.

FAQs: Your Solar Storage Questions Answered

Q: How much roof space do I need? A: A 5kW system requires about 30–40 m², depending on panel efficiency.

Q: Can systems withstand Asmara's dry climate? A> Absolutely! Modern PV panels thrive in low-humidity environments.
